How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Dallas?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Dallas Studio Apartments | $1,390 | $556 | $9,657 |
| Dallas 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,525 | $575 | $10,000+ |
| Dallas 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,014 | $669 | $10,000+ |
| Dallas 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,645 | $765 | $10,000+ |
| Dallas 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,276 | $899 | $10,000+ |
| Dallas 5 Bedroom Apartments | $11,732 | $2,395 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Dallas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Dallas with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Dallas is at Rise at Highland Meadows listed at $570.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Dallas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Dallas is $1,525.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Dallas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Dallas is a 2,434 square feet unit starting from $3,827 at Mosaic Dallas.
What is the average size for Dallas 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Dallas is currently 806 sq ft.
